Público
Público is often regarded as one of Portugal's leading newspapers, known for its in-depth reporting and comprehensive coverage of national and international news. It's like the New York Times of Portugal! Público is known for its high journalistic standards and its commitment to providing objective and balanced reporting. This makes it a reliable source of information for anyone seeking to understand Portuguese society and its place in the world. The newspaper's website offers a wealth of articles, opinion pieces, and multimedia content, covering a wide range of topics from politics and economics to culture and technology.
One of the key strengths of Público is its focus on investigative journalism. The newspaper has a dedicated team of reporters who delve deep into complex issues, uncovering hidden truths and holding power to account. This commitment to investigative reporting has earned Público numerous awards and accolades, solidifying its reputation as a champion of journalistic integrity. By exposing corruption, uncovering wrongdoing, and shedding light on important social issues, Público plays a vital role in promoting transparency and accountability in Portuguese society. Its investigative pieces often spark public debate and lead to meaningful reforms, demonstrating the power of journalism to effect positive change.

Expresso
Expresso isn't just a newspaper; it's a weekly publication that provides a more in-depth analysis of current events. Think of it as your weekend read to catch up on everything important. Expresso distinguishes itself through its comprehensive analysis of political and economic developments. Each week, the newspaper publishes detailed reports and opinion pieces that dissect the latest policy decisions, economic trends, and political maneuvers. This in-depth analysis provides readers with a deeper understanding of the forces shaping Portuguese society and its place in the global arena. Whether you're a business professional, a policy maker, or simply an informed citizen, Expresso offers valuable insights that can help you make sense of the complex world around you.

Diário de Notícias
Diário de Notícias is one of the oldest Portuguese newspapers, with a long and storied history. It offers a more traditional perspective on the news. Diário de Notícias has a long and storied history, dating back to 1864. Over the years, the newspaper has played a significant role in shaping public opinion and influencing political discourse in Portugal. Its longevity is a testament to its enduring relevance and its ability to adapt to changing times. Today, Diário de Notícias continues to be a trusted source of information for readers across the country, providing comprehensive coverage of national and international news.

Jornal de Notícias
Jornal de Notícias is particularly strong in its coverage of regional news, especially in the northern part of Portugal. So, if you're interested in what's happening in Porto and the surrounding areas, this is your go-to. Jornal de Notícias prides itself on its comprehensive coverage of local events, issues, and personalities. Its team of reporters are embedded in communities throughout the region, allowing them to report on stories that might otherwise go unnoticed. From local government meetings to community festivals, Jornal de Notícias covers it all, providing readers with a sense of connection to their local communities.
